CHICAGO - A suburban Chicago subject has been arrested for allegedly making death threats against federal law enforcement and prominent political figures, the FBI's Chicago office confirmed.

What we know:

Federal investigators say the alleged threats were directed at Immigration and Customs Enforcement agents and several high-profile political figures.

The FBI made the arrest Friday morning, and charges are expected to be announced later today. Image 1 of 2 ▼
